Cincinnati Financial Net Debt Growth & History (CINF)
Cincinnati Financial's net debt was −$570.0M for fiscal 2025.
View full Cincinnati Financial company overviewCincinnati Financial annual net debt history
| Fiscal year | Period ended | Net debt | Change | Growth |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2025 | 2025-12-31 | −$570.0M | −$437.0M | — |
| 2024 | 2024-12-31 | −$133.0M | −$75.0M | — |
| 2023 | 2023-12-31 | −$58.0M | $365.0M | — |
| 2022 | 2022-12-31 | −$423.0M | −$127.0M | — |
| 2021 | 2021-12-31 | −$296.0M | −$241.0M | — |
| 2020 | 2020-12-31 | −$55.0M | −$134.0M | — |
| 2019 | 2019-12-31 | $79.0M | $29.0M | +58.00% |
| 2018 | 2018-12-31 | $50.0M | −$120.0M | −70.59% |
| 2017 | 2017-12-31 | $170.0M | $121.0M | +246.94% |
| 2016 | 2016-12-31 | $49.0M | −$228.0M | −82.31% |
| 2015 | 2015-12-31 | $277.0M | $46.0M | +19.91% |
| 2014 | 2014-12-31 | $231.0M | −$171.0M | −42.54% |
| 2013 | 2013-12-31 | $402.0M | $62.0M | +18.24% |
| 2012 | 2012-12-31 | $340.0M | −$43.0M | −11.23% |
| 2011 | 2011-12-31 | $383.0M | −$39.0M | −9.24% |
| 2010 | 2010-12-31 | $422.0M | $189.0M | +81.12% |
| 2009 | 2009-12-31 | $233.0M | — | — |

Cincinnati Financial net debt trends
Over the last five fiscal years, Cincinnati Financial's net debt decreased from −$55.0M to −$570.0M, a change of −$515.0M. The latest reported quarter, Q2 2026, shows −$891.0M.
What net debt means
Net debt compares a company’s interest-bearing debt with its cash and cash equivalents. Positive net debt means debt exceeds cash, while a negative value indicates the company has more cash than debt on this measure.
How net debt is calculated
TickerStat calculates net debt as total interest-bearing debt minus cash and cash equivalents at the same reporting-period end. Short-term investments are not subtracted because they are not included in the standardized cash series. Fiscal periods can differ from calendar years, so exact period-end dates are included.
